Ingredients List
To embark on your culinary adventure, you will need the following ingredients:
– 1 cup of semi-sweet chocolate chips
– 2 tablespoons of coconut oil
– 1/2 cup of powdered sugar
– 1/4 cup of unsweetened cocoa powder
– 1/4 teaspoon of peppermint extract
– 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la extract
– Pinch of salt
– Optional: crushed mint leaves or candy canes for garnish

Step-by-Step Instructions
Let’s dive into the process of making those delicious Homemade Mint Chocolate Rounds. Follow these detailed steps for success:
1. Melt Chocolate: Begin by placing the semi-sweet chocolate chips and coconut oil into a microwave-safe bowl. Heat in intervals of 30 seconds, stirring between each, until fully melted and smooth. This step is critical to achieving the right texture.
2. Combine Dry Ingredients: In a separate mixing bowl, whisk together the powdered sugar, unsweetened cocoa powder, and a pinch of salt. This will help distribute the flavors evenly.
3. Mix Wet Ingredients: Once your chocolate mixture is melted, add in the peppermint and vanilla extracts. Stir well to combine; the warm chocolate will absorb the flavors beautifully.
4. Blend Everything Together: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the melted chocolate until a creamy dough forms. If it’s too thick, you can add a splash of warm water to achieve a softer consistency.
5. Shape Rounds: Scoop out tablespoon-sized portions of the mixture and roll them into balls. Flatten them slightly to create round disks. This is where you can get creative—aim for about 1/2 inch thick.
6. Chill: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and place your rounds on it. Allow them to chill in the refrigerator for 20 minutes. This will help firm them up and enhance their texture.
7. Garnish (Optional): For a decorative touch, feel free to sprinkle crushed mint leaves or bits of candy canes on top of each round after removing them from the refrigerator.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
When making these Homemade Mint Chocolate Rounds, avoiding common pitfalls is essential in making the cooking process smooth and successful:
– Overheating Chocolate: Be cautious when melting your chocolate. Ensure it doesn’t get too hot to avoid a burnt taste or grainy texture.
– Not Chilling Long Enough: Failing to chill the rounds adequately may result in a gooey texture that doesn’t hold up well.
– Skipping the Salt: A pinch of salt may seem unnecessary, but it enhances the flavor; skipping it can dull the taste of your treats.

FAQs
How do I store these rounds?
Store the rounds in an airtight container in the refrigerator, where they will last for up to a week.
Can I freeze these rounds?
Yes, you can freeze them for up to three months. Just ensure that they are well-wrapped to prevent freezer burn.
Are these rounds gluten-free?
Yes, all of the listed ingredients are gluten-free, making them a suitable option for those with gluten sensitivities.
Can I use fresh mint instead of extract?
Absolutely! Use finely chopped fresh mint leaves instead of extract for a fresher taste.
What can I use if I don’t have coconut oil?
You can substitute coconut oil with another neutral oil or unsalted butter for the melting process.

Homemade Mint Chocolate Rounds
Ingredients
- 1 cup dark chocolate chips
- 1/2 cup sweetened condensed milk
- 1 teaspoon peppermint extract
- 1/4 cup crushed mint candies
- 1/2 cup powdered sugar
Instructions
- Melt the chocolate chips in a microwave-safe bowl, stirring every 30 seconds until smooth.
- Mix in the sweetened condensed milk and peppermint extract until well combined.
- Stir in the crushed mint candies.
- Drop spoonfuls of the mixture onto a parchment-lined baking sheet.
- Chill in the refrigerator for at least 15 minutes until set.
- Dust with powdered sugar before serving.
